Abstract "Recently, much research attention has been paid to the rare earth ions since they bear unique electronic and optical characteristics arising from their 4f electrons. The luminescence features of rare earth ions include high luminescence quantum yield, narrow bandwidth, long-lived emission, large Stokes shifts, ligand-dependent luminescence sensitization, which have received startling interest because of the continuously expanding need for luminescent materials meeting the stringent requirements of telecommunication, lighting, electroluminescent devices, (bio-) analytical sensors, bioimaging set-ups and solar cells. In particular, rare earth orthophosphates (REPO4) have been extensively studied because of their potential applications in color displays, field-effect transistors, optoelectronics, solar cells, and light sources"-- Provided by publisher.
